Early Life
Cody Lee Martin attended Davie County High School in Mocksville, North Carolina, where he began to develop his basketball skills.
He later transferred to Oak Hill Academy in Virginia, a prestigious school known for its athletic programs, where he gained national recognition for his talents while playing alongside other skilled players.
After high school, he played college basketball at NC State for two years before transferring to the University of Nevada, where he made a notable impact on the team’s success.
Furthermore, Cody has a brother, Caleb Martin, who is also a professional basketball player, demonstrating the athletic talent present in their family.

Career
Cody Lee Martin is a professional basketball player who has made a noteworthy impact in the NBA since being drafted 36th in total by the Charlotte Hornets in the 2019 NBA Draft.
Over his six-year career, he has appeared in 259 games, demonstrating his versatility as a small forward. Martin’s best season came in 2021-22, where he averaged 12.7 points and 4.6 rebounds per game while shooting an impressive 48.2% from the field.
As of the current 2024-25 season, he is averaging 11.7 points per game with a shooting percentage of 41.8%. In February 2025, he was traded to the Phoenix Suns, marking a new chapter in his career after several prosperous years with the Hornets.
Net Worth
Cody Martin’s net worth is estimated to be around $10 million, considerably supported by his multi-year $31 million contract with the Charlotte Hornets.
As of the 2024-25 season, he is drawing an annual salary of $8,120,000. Throughout his NBA career, his top salaries have included $1,620,000 in the 2019-20 season, $1,782,000 in the 2020-21 season, $2,000,000 in the 2021-22 season, $4,000,000 in the 2022-23 season, and $8,120,000 in the 2024-25 season.
